应用应用分布式事务分布式事务分布式事务分布式事务分布式事务分布式事务子子事事务务子子事事务务子子事事务务子子事事务务子子事事务务子子事事务务输入:汇出金额和转出输入:汇出金额和转出/转入账号转入账号事务开始:检查转出账号中事务开始:检查转出账号中是否又足够的转出资金是否又足够的转出资金更新转出账号存款余额更新转出账号存款余额创建代理创建代理Agent向代理送信息:转入帐号,金额向代理送信息:转入帐号,金额等待来自等待来自Agent的消息的消息成功成功提交事务:成功结束提交事务:成功结束否否撤销事务:失败结束撤销事务:失败结束接收来自根代理的消息接收来自根代理的消息更新转入账号存款余额更新转入账号存款余额发送执行消息给根代理发送执行消息给根代理(成功或失败)(成功或失败)站 点 1 站 点 3 站 点 2本地事务管理器本地事务管理器LTM1分布式事务管理器分布式事务管理器DTM1分布式事务管理器分布式事务管理器DTM1本地事务管理器本地事务管理器LTM2分布式事务管理器分布式事务管理器DTM1本地事务管理器本地事务管理器LTM3activePartiallycommittedcommittedfailedterminated精品课件精品课件!精品课件精品课件!